Germany’s WM SE has acquired 100 percent of the shares of Trost Autoservice Technik SE, headquartered in Stuttgart, Germany. The deal closed on April 27. The combination of the two companies – formerly No. 2 and No. 3 in the German aftermarket – will form Europe’s largest warehouse distributor with revenues exceeding 1.5 billion euros (approximately $1.7 USD), operating more than 200 warehouse locations in Germany and five other countries. Part of the group is South San Francisco’s SSF Imported Auto Parts LLC, which just opened a new distribution center in Atlanta, Georgia, USA, through the recent acquisition of German Auto Parts.
WM and SSF start Global One Automotive
Global One Automotive, a strategic alliance of internationally leading and progressive aftermarket distributors, has been founded in Frankfurt. The focus will primarily be on Europe and North America, where discussions with potential members are already on the way. Global One will be headed by Gerald Forster, who has 35 years of aftermarket experience and managed the aftermarket business for Germany’s Eberspaecher for the past 16 years. WM and SSF are the founding members of Global One.
